Footprints in the Dust By Elias Vesper Step into a world where every choice leaves a mark, watched by an unseen angelic observer. In Footprints in the Dust, Elias Vesper weaves a haunting anthology of human struggle and resilience, blending the emotional warmth of Highway to Heaven with the surreal twists of The Twilight Zone. Follow Gabe, an angel disguised as a drifter, as he chronicles lives across America's heartland-from the Dust Bowl's parched despair to the industrial grit of 1950s factories. Each standalone story unveils the profound ripple effects of human decisions: a farmer's desperate sacrifice, a worker's forbidden theft, a bridge keeper's haunting guilt. With lyrical prose and a philosopher's eye, Vesper explores faith, free will, and the interconnectedness of lives, revealing how even the smallest act can echo through time.
